Heads up — our zero-downtime schema migrations run through Ledgerline's managed tooling, so you shouldn't ever be applying DDL by hand against the primary. Their expand-contract pipeline handles dual writes and backfill automatically. If a migration stalls mid-backfill, don't cancel it; cancellation can strand shadow columns and that cleanup is miserable. Pause it from the Ledgerline console instead, then loop in their support crew. For stalled or ambiguous migration states, reach them at the address below.

escalation mailbox, yafog-kafof: eliok@xolmarcloud.local

## Meet Tallygrub, our metrics sidecar

Every Pondward service ships with Tallygrub riding alongside it, scooping up counters and shipping them to the aggregator every 15 seconds. If a customer reports missing graphs, first check whether the sidecar restarted recently — that's the culprit nine times out of ten. Restart steps and the flush-interval knobs are all written up here:

runbook for hawif-tajeg: https://grafana.plorvasoft.example/dash

External plugin authors: do not override
 * this constant at runtime — the bot caches it at startup, and a
 * mid-scan change can cause branches to be flagged inconsistently.
 * Instead, supply your own threshold via the plugin manifest, which
 * Tidewatch merges during initialization. Any branch older than the
 * effective threshold is queued for deletion after a seven-day grace
 * notice. This constant was last validated against the bot build
 * recorded below.
 */

session token of tajog-fahaf = htk21_4ae55819f45410afcb307

Hello plugin authors,

Next Thursday, Corbexa will run a disaster-recovery drill for the RestockRoute vending-machine restock planner. During the failover window, plugin callbacks will be replayed against the standby scheduler, so please ensure your handlers are idempotent and tolerate duplicate route assignments. No customer restock data will be altered. To re-register your plugin against the standby environment during the drill, authenticate with the recovery passphrase provided below.

vault phrase of hahip-tajeg = quenax-briath-briax